On Wednesday, August 14, 2024, the College of Islamic Sciences at the University of Fallujah discussed the higher diploma thesis equivalent to a master’s degree entitled “The Role of the Anbar Tribes in Maintaining Community Peace and Security - An Applied Study.”
The thesis submitted by the student Watban Jamal Saadoun Eifan, under the supervision of Prof. Dr. Muhammad Ibrahim Abdel Majeed, to explain the role of the Iraqi tribes, including their notables, notables, and individuals, in maintaining security and community peace through the sacrifices and support they provide to the security authorities in the state.
The discussion committee was headed by Mr. Dr. Muhammad Jassim Abd, and its membership included Professor Moataz Ismail Khalaf and Professor Muhammad Abdul Karim Abdul Rahman.
The results of the letter made it clear that the task of maintaining security and peace in any society or country is not limited to the state’s security departments, but rather is a lofty task on the shoulders of every member of society.
